Rolls-Royce Holdings plc (FRA:RRU)
Germany flag Germany · Delayed Price · Currency is EUR
12.66
-0.06 (-0.47%)
At close: Aug 8, 2025, 10:00 PM CET

Beacon Roofing Supply Balance Sheet

Millions GBP. Fiscal year is Jan - Dec.
Fiscal Year
TTMFY 2024FY 2023FY 2022FY 2021FY 20202016 - 2020
Period Ending
Jun '25 Dec '24 Dec '23 Dec '22 Dec '21 Dec '20 2016 - 2020
Cash & Equivalents
6,0445,5753,7842,6072,6213,452
Upgrade
Short-Term Investments
---118-
Upgrade
Trading Asset Securities
8614882-42
Upgrade
Cash & Short-Term Investments
6,1305,7233,7922,6202,6293,494
Upgrade
Cash Growth
41.38%50.92%44.73%-0.34%-24.76%-22.32%
Upgrade
Accounts Receivable
4,6904,8684,0063,9003,6663,989
Upgrade
Other Receivables
2,8223,0082,8692,7862,2762,194
Upgrade
Receivables
7,5127,8766,8756,6865,9426,183
Upgrade
Inventory
5,6115,0924,8484,7083,6663,690
Upgrade
Prepaid Expenses
2,7762,5862,4541,779950837
Upgrade
Other Current Assets
6543492512182,128415
Upgrade
Total Current Assets
22,68321,62618,22016,01115,31514,619
Upgrade
Property, Plant & Equipment
4,5174,4854,6334,9975,1205,920
Upgrade
Long-Term Investments
1,289707764894616671
Upgrade
Goodwill
1,0091,0091,0641,0991,0261,074
Upgrade
Other Intangible Assets
6286276958198741,776
Upgrade
Long-Term Deferred Tax Assets
3,4753,6602,9982,7312,2491,826
Upgrade
Long-Term Deferred Charges
2,8512,7662,2502,1802,1412,295
Upgrade
Other Long-Term Assets
1,4888068887191,3331,336
Upgrade
Total Assets
37,94035,68631,51229,45028,67429,517
Upgrade
Accounts Payable
2,3332,0182,1502,3021,7582,001
Upgrade
Accrued Expenses
3,6622,6061,2261,5651,4011,449
Upgrade
Short-Term Debt
225327307
Upgrade
Current Portion of Long-Term Debt
1,8058225142727745
Upgrade
Current Portion of Leases
323296278355270259
Upgrade
Current Income Taxes Payable
53117143104101154
Upgrade
Current Unearned Revenue
7,0786,3356,1284,8463,6274,203
Upgrade
Other Current Liabilities
2,9624,5674,4344,7173,9684,810
Upgrade
Total Current Liabilities
18,21816,76314,92613,91811,15913,928
Upgrade
Long-Term Debt
1,8142,8873,6414,2036,1054,387
Upgrade
Long-Term Leases
1,0931,2591,3821,4921,4741,784
Upgrade
Long-Term Unearned Revenue
9,6309,4718,4927,3786,7496,311
Upgrade
Long-Term Deferred Tax Liabilities
224231330286451494
Upgrade
Other Long-Term Liabilities
3,5854,9755,3357,1565,9995,908
Upgrade
Total Liabilities
35,50636,56735,14135,46633,31034,392
Upgrade
Common Stock
1,6911,7011,6841,6741,6741,674
Upgrade
Additional Paid-In Capital
-1,0121,0121,0121,0121,012
Upgrade
Retained Earnings
387-4,435-7,212-9,816-8,525-8,914
Upgrade
Comprehensive Income & Other
3308108351,0801,1771,331
Upgrade
Total Common Equity
2,408-912-3,681-6,050-4,662-4,897
Upgrade
Minority Interest
263152342622
Upgrade
Shareholders' Equity
2,434-881-3,629-6,016-4,636-4,875
Upgrade
Total Liabilities & Equity
37,94035,68631,51229,45028,67429,517
Upgrade
Total Debt
5,0375,2665,8686,0797,8837,482
Upgrade
Net Cash (Debt)
1,093457-2,076-3,459-5,254-3,988
Upgrade
Net Cash Per Share
0.130.05-0.25-0.41-0.63-0.67
Upgrade
Filing Date Shares Outstanding
8,4248,3998,3648,3568,3388,328
Upgrade
Total Common Shares Outstanding
8,4248,3998,3648,3568,3388,328
Upgrade
Working Capital
4,4654,8633,2942,0934,156691
Upgrade
Book Value Per Share
0.29-0.11-0.44-0.72-0.56-0.59
Upgrade
Tangible Book Value
771-2,548-5,440-7,968-6,562-7,747
Upgrade
Tangible Book Value Per Share
0.09-0.30-0.65-0.95-0.79-0.93
Upgrade
Land
1,8701,8821,8831,9361,8651,994
Upgrade
Machinery
6,0436,0095,9686,2246,0326,467
Upgrade
Construction In Progress
544527404391292443
Upgrade
Order Backlog
-82,10068,50060,20050,60052,900
Upgrade
Source: S&P Global Market Intelligence. Standard template. Financial Sources.